Indian women's lifestyle and culture are characterized by a deep-rooted blend of ancient traditions and rapidly evolving modern aspirations. The experience varies significantly across urban and rural landscapes, religious communities, and socioeconomic backgrounds. 1. Cultural Foundations and Family Life

The family is the cornerstone of Indian society, and women often serve as its primary emotional and social anchors.

Family Structure: Many families remain patrilineal and multi-generational, where the bride traditionally moves in with her in-laws. Decisions are often hierarchical, with elders and men holding significant authority.

Marriage: Most marriages are arranged, though "love marriages" are increasingly common in urban centers. Weddings are culturally significant, often celebrated with elaborate, multi-day ceremonies.

Traditional Arts: Women are the primary keepers of traditional folk arts, such as Rangoli (decorative floor patterns) and regional music and dance, which are integral to daily life and festivals. 2. Traditional and Modern Dress

Clothing is a vibrant expression of regional identity and personal style.

The Saree: A timeless six-yard fabric draped in various regional styles. It remains the most iconic attire for formal occasions and daily wear.

Salwar Kameez & Kurta Sets: Popular for their comfort and practicality, these are standard daily wear for many.

Fusion Wear: Younger generations often blend Western and Indian styles, such as pairing a saree with a crop top or wearing ethnic motifs on modern silhouettes.

Adornments: Items like the bindi (forehead mark) and bangles are common beauty elements. 3. Lifestyle and Socioeconomic Roles

Indian women are increasingly prominent in professional and public life, though traditional expectations persist. The Spiritual Start: Lighting a diya (lamp) in

Education and Career: There is a significant push for female education, and women are making strides in fields like medicine, engineering, and tech. However, workforce participation remains relatively low (around 21%) due to societal pressures and the "double burden" of household labor.

Political Leadership: India has a long history of powerful women leaders, including Indira Gandhi (former Prime Minister) and current women parliamentarians.

Social Challenges: Despite legal progress, many women still navigate issues like the dowry system, son preference, and safety concerns in public spaces. 4. Changing Perspectives Recent surveys show a complex shift in societal views:

Equality: Roughly 80% of Indians believe it is very important for women to have the same rights as men.

Safety: There is a growing consensus that teaching respect to boys is more critical for women's safety than restricting girls' behavior.

Jewelry as Bank and Blessing

Gold is culturally paramount. For an Indian woman, gold isn't just decoration; it is Streedhan (woman's wealth)—a financial safety net untouched by the husband’s family. From the Mangalsutra (a sacred necklace signifying marriage) to the Bichiya (toe rings), every ornament has a biological or spiritual basis rooted in Ayurvedic pressure points.
